Full description

Readme.txt: TSCreator-7.4_05Apr2019_ISPRangeColumn.java: includes detailed data structures for evolutionary range points and ranges, and tree-drawing utility functions. TSCreator-7.4_05Apr2019_ISPImageGenerator.java: draws evolutionary tree data column and generates the final chart. TSCreator-7.4_05Apr2019_ISPMain.java: includes the main function which is the entry point to the software and spawns the Java process on a Java Virtual Machine. The TimeScale Creator software platform is freely available at https://timescalecreator.org/download/download.php, from where it can be downloaded as a Java archive (Jar) file or Windows executable (exe) file. Instructions to install TimeScale Creator and load datapacks are given in the following file included in this collection: Instructions_for_TSCreator_datapacks.pdf.

Significance statement

Code for the Integrated Species–Phenon Tree: software which merges ancestor–descendant proposals for fossil morphotaxa (phena) with reconstructed phylogenies of lineages (species), to digitally visualize infraspecific diversity within species through deep time.
